3.3 Wiring note
1.Installing / removing the cable or connector must be done after checking the power supply off.
2.Wiring should not have bare cables exposed between connector contacts.
3.Network cables should be fixed without tension. Cables fixed under tension have potential of causing a
communication fault by to be removed a connector.
4.In order to avoid noise problems, the shield of the bus cable should be grounded by clamping it to a metal
surface connected to PE for proper grounding. Refer to Figure.3-1.
5.A terminating resistor is not built-in the unit. Please provide it.
6.Ensure external emergency stop measures are taken to stop the inverter, in the event of a network fault.
(a) Remove the Power supply of the Inverter when the network master detects a communication fault.
(b) When the master detects a communication fault, turn on the intelligent input terminal which would be
allocated (FRS), (RS) and/or (EXT) function.
